An Accidental Reveal That Couldn't Stay Hidden
In a move that's becoming almost traditional in the gaming industry, the collaboration was accidentally unveiled through a YouTube Short that appeared on the official Overwatch channel before being hastily deleted. One can imagine the panic in the marketing department as someone realized they'd hit "publish" a bit too enthusiastically. But as anyone who's spent more than five minutes on the internet knows, nothing truly disappears once it's been posted online. Screenshots were captured faster than Tracer can blink through time, ensuring that this premature announcement became very much official, even if unintentionally so.

The timing of this reveal carries a certain poetic quality, arriving just as NieR: Automata approaches its ninth anniversary. It seems fitting that a game centered around cyclical existence and repeating patterns would find itself looping back into the cultural spotlight through such an unexpected venue. The crossover is scheduled to launch on March 10, 2026, riding alongside the mid-season patch that drops at 11:00 AM PT (or 7:00 PM GMT for those keeping track across the pond).
YoRHa Units Assemble: The Skin Lineup
The brief glimpse provided before the video's untimely demise confirmed that five Overwatch heroes are getting the Project YoRHa treatment. These fortunate characters—Mercy, Kiriko, Wuyang, Lifeweaver, and Vendetta—will be reimagined as iconic androids from Yoko Taro's dystopian masterpiece. 🎮

Community Concerns and Clarifications
As with any major announcement, initial reactions included a healthy dose of anxiety alongside the excitement. Some fans immediately raised concerns about potential region locks—a worry that's not entirely unfounded given how certain collaborations have been handled in the past. Different licensing agreements and regional restrictions have occasionally meant that not everyone gets equal access to crossover content.
However, early community discussion and moderator responses suggest this will be a standard global event rollout. No artificial barriers based on geography, no frustrating workarounds required. Everyone, everywhere, should be able to dress their favorite heroes in android attire when March 10 rolls around. 🌍
